About this work

This painting shows a simple seaside scene. A small white house with a brown roof sits near the water, with two bare trees in front. The beach has yellow sand and a few scattered shells. In the distance, a ship floats on the blue sea, and a lighthouse stands on the shore. The brushstrokes are loose and quick, giving the painting a rough, textured look. About the artist

Portrait of Micaela Eleutheriade
Artist

Micaela Eleutheriade

Micaela Eleutheriade (1900–1982) was a noted Romanian painter and engraver. She was a descendant, through her mother, of the painter Gheorghe Tattarescu, the pioneer of neoclassicism in Romania.
